Many of you know that so called
Hybrid PhysX setups (using ATI GPU for graphics and Nvidia GPU for PhysX – in one system) are
officially banned by Nvidia. Unofficially – available through
GenL PhysX mod. However, all this hacking and patching isn’t appropriate for certain users, not to mention that Nvidia can find a way to block Hybrids completely one day.
New
Lucid Hydra, technology that can split graphics rendering even between ATI and Nvidia GPUs in Multi-GPU setups, was rumored as
compromising solution for Hybrid PhysX problem. (can’t say we believed in that).
Unfortunatelly, recent tests of
MSI Big Bang Fuzion, first motherboard with Hydra Engine inside, have shown finally –
No. It’s not working this way.
According to
Big Bang Fuzion review by GURU 3D
What if you want to enjoy PhysX in X-mode? – well you can’t, as the minute the NVIDIA driver sees an ATI card, it will disable it.
Batman Arkham Asylum benchmarks from
Big Bang overview by tomshardware.com are showing that there is no benefit from ATI+NV combo setup
